Concrete AI Opportunities with ROI Framing

1. Intelligent R&D: The Formulation Co-Pilot

Nazdar's business hinges on creating custom inks for specific substrates and print heads. This R&D process is iterative, material-intensive, and slow. An AI-powered formulation engine can analyze decades of recipe data, material properties, and performance outcomes to predict successful new formulations. The ROI is clear: reducing development cycles from weeks to days slashes labor costs and gets products to market faster, while minimizing raw material waste in testing directly improves gross margin.

2. Vision-Driven Manufacturing Consistency

Industrial ink quality is paramount. Minor variations in color or viscosity can cause costly press downtime for clients. Implementing computer vision systems on filling and mixing lines allows for real-time, non-contact inspection of every batch. This move from statistical sampling to 100% inspection drastically reduces the risk of returns and reputation-damaging defects. The investment in sensors and ML models pays back through guaranteed quality, reduced liability, and enhanced customer trust.

3. Predictive Supply Chain Orchestration

Nazdar's raw materials, like pigments and resins, are subject to volatile pricing and geopolitical supply shocks. Machine learning models can ingest data on commodity markets, logistics delays, and production forecasts to recommend optimal purchase timing and inventory levels. For a mid-sized manufacturer, freeing up working capital trapped in excess inventory and avoiding premium spot purchases can yield significant, recurring cash flow improvements.

Deployment Risks Specific to a 500-1000 Employee Company

Implementing AI at Nazdar's scale carries distinct risks beyond technical challenges. First, data readiness: valuable formulation knowledge may reside in lab notebooks or veteran chemists' expertise, not in clean, digital databases. A significant upfront investment in data engineering is required. Second, talent and culture: attracting AI/ML talent is difficult against tech giants, and integrating them with tenured production teams requires careful change management. Third, capital allocation missteps: with limited budget for experimentation, picking the wrong initial pilot (too broad, or with unclear metrics) can stall the entire initiative. Success depends on executive sponsorship to fund the data foundation and choosing a pilot project with a direct, measurable impact on cost of goods sold or customer acquisition time.
